Title :
A novel structure of multi-level high voltage source inverter
Author :
Kim, Young-Seok ; Seo, Beom-Seok ; Hyun, Dong-seok
Author_Institution :
Dept. of Electr. Eng., Hanyang Univ., Seoul, South Korea
Abstract :
The authors deal with a new multi-level high voltage source inverter with GTO thyristors. A multi-level approach seems to be best suited for implementing high voltage conversion system because it leads to harmonic reduction and deals with safely high power conversion system independent of the dynamic switching characteristics of each power semiconductor device. However, a conventional multi-level inverter has some problems; voltage unbalance between DC-link capacitors and overvoltages across the inner switching devices. Therefore, they propose a novel structure of a multi-level inverter improving these problems
